WebTongue-tie (ankyloglossia) happens when the tissue that attaches the tongue to the bottom of the mouth (lingual frenulum) is too short and tight. This can limit the tongue’s movement. Tongue-tie is present at birth. ... Tongue exercises can help loosen the lingual frenulum. With a clean finger, lift your baby’s tongue on both sides and ... Tongue-tie can interfere with activities such as licking an ice cream … harley pasternak body reset diet recipesWebThe common term for ankyloglossia is tongue tie. In this condition, the tongue is literally “tied,” or tethered, to the floor of the mouth, sometimes inhibiting both speech and eating. A child is born with this condition.
